Also, lets not forget that a recovery in inevitable after a big recession. It had to come sooner or later, so it's really no accolade for Obama to have seen a recovery within 8 years of his post-recession presidency. Similarly, the boom period has to end at some point, and there's no shame in it ending after 10 or 11 years.

Simply put, Obama was neither to blame for the crisis he inherited nor to praise for presiding over a tepid recovery. Trump is neither to praise for a good economy he inherited nor to blame for the cycle eventually ending.


What presidents can actually influence is not the occurrence of upswings and downswings, but their intensity and timing.
Obama has to bear some blame for the sluggish recovery, Trump has to get some praise for kicking the economy into overdrive and probably having extended the boom cycle for a couple of years. He also has to carry some blame for his trade wars potentially having ended the bull market a bit earlier than necessary.
